Study On Collection Scope And Compensation Standard Of Rural Collective Land

Farmers petition frequently happen due to the insufficient rural collective land expropriation compensation. The land expropriation system reform is not only the key of land system reform in China, but also is a difficult problem. It has became the biggest obstacle to land expropriation system reform that how to determine the scope of "public interests" and compensation standard. The reasons of the obstacle are legislative technical problem, redistribution of vested interests and so on. In 2007, "Real Right Law of the People’s Republic of China" still avoided these two problems,which was expected by various circles of society. In 2011, the Chinese government issued “The State-owned Land on the Housing Acquisition and Compensation Ordinance”, in order to regulate the state-owned land expropriation compensation. However, the ordinance still has not been available which was used in collective land expropriation and compensation. The third plenary session of 18 further cleared land requisition system reform direction, which contained to narrow the scope of land requisition and achieve fair compensation in main points of the reform part. That enhanced the urgency of the two problems study.The thesis takes the rural collective land as the research object and holds collective land expropriation problem as the breakthrough point. First, the thesis will systematic analyze "public interests" definition of land expropriation system reform and compensation standard. Second,it will research related theory, refer China mainland experience and study local government the case of land requisition compensation. Third, it will put forward the ideas, which are suitable for the situation of our country, specific for scientific defining the scope of collective land expropriation. Then, it will clear the determination of fair compensation standard basis and principles. Finally, it will present different advices of collective land expropriation compensation standard problem, under the policy framework for the current system and the target in the future of land expropriation system reform.Research suggests that:(1)Public interests has broad and narrow sense,Hong Kong and Taiwan and foreign countries use two ways to define. The first way is public interests will completely rule out profit-making business project sites. The second way is administrative agencies or legislative bodies decide to expropriation which part of profit-making business land.( 2) The scope of collective land expropriation has a strong correlation with which compensation standard to be chosen. There is an important precondition to form the fair market value standard. The precondition is scientific define public interests and the scope of land requisition, then allow the collective business land directly entering land market.(3)Under our current land system and policy framework, China does not have appropriate market condition to realize fair market value standard, maintains living standard maybe is a more rational choice.(4)The collective land expropriation compensation is a special market. It will be biased to determine compensation standards only according to the original land use or best use. This kind of practice will difficult to balance fairness.(5)China policies set a lot of land expropriation compensation modes. The local government should be considering the local characteristics,flexible using these modes, even making a combination, trying to provide more modes. The finally choice is decided by landless peasants themselves.The thesis suggests, on the basis of scientific assessment of the primary use land value, appropriately considering land value-added produced by planning purposes change, but blindly increasing compensation standard may not be able to achieve each side satisfying result. There has a strong relationship between the formation of fair and reasonable compensation standard and collective construction land market openness degree.
